What is automatic bill payment?
Automatic payments (also referred to as automatic bill payments) are payments that a merchant automatically withdraws from a customer's bank or credit union account. An automatic payment arrangement is often used to pay bills — for example, a monthly credit card bill.
What does automatic billing mean?
Automated billing is a system that enables businesses to streamline and automate their billing, invoicing, and payment processes, making them faster, simpler, and more efficient.
What is the meaning of autopay payment?
Autopay feature enables the bank to automatically debit your account and pay the bill. This facility is available for select billers who send details of bills due to the bank for online display and payment. When you add a new biller for bill payment through Internet, you can define autopay settings.
What is an automatic bill payment?
Automatic payments (also referred to as automatic bill payments) are payments that a merchant automatically withdraws from a customer's bank or credit union account. An automatic payment arrangement is often used to pay bills — for example, a monthly credit card bill.
What is the difference between bill payment and automatic payment?
Well, you can think of autopay and bill pay in a similar way: autopay is bill pay but bill pay is not autopay. Let us explain–autopay allows you to pay your bills every month through recurring transfers from your checking account, automating the bill payment.
What is an example of an automatic payment?
Below are a few examples of expenses that can typically be paid using automatic payments: Utility bills. Car loan payments. Rent and mortgage payments.
What does automated billing mean?
An automated billing system enables users to automate their billing process. Rather than having to stamp and mail paper bills, you can pay your vendors online with the click of a button.
